Cho Chun-ying (traditional Chinese: 卓春英), a Taiwanese female politician, is the deputy secretary of the ROC Presidential Office Department of Public Affairs. She is formerly vice magistrate of Kaohsiung County and acting mayor of Tainan City.[1]
